🪸 How Do I Get to Sombrero Reef?
Sombrero Reef is one of the most popular snorkeling and diving spots in the Florida Keys, located about five nautical miles south of Pigeon Key and Vaca Key in Marathon.
It’s part of the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ary and marked by the historic Sombrero Key Lighthouse, which rises 142 feet above the reef.
The reef is only accessible by boat — you can launch your own or take a local snorkeling charter from one of Marathon’s marinas.
